    Working ok before earth fault tripped RCD @consumer unit. Found low insulation resistance reading on Heater-element. Replaced element. Now the pumps running(?) – but no water enters machine – nothing else seams to happen. Program light buttons flash. Door can be opened at any-time.

    That’s a no fill error, the pump running noise may well be the fill valve humming. Have you checked the water supply is OK ?

    Apart from that, I’d go with Greg and check the base for water (flood protection activated) with the power off of course 😉

    I checked out the water pressure to the machine and “Float Switch” and both check out OK. No sign of water leaking in the machine.

    I put water into the machine and started it running. A pump starts.
    I opened the door and found the water I put in has gone.

    After a while, there is the sound of water running.

    About 1 1/2 minutes after starting the machine, a pump starts again and the same light that is second from the left starts flashing.
    This sound of pump and water runs last about thirty seconds and then all gose quiet.

    The error fault (2nd light from left flashing) means there is a HEATING fault if I’m not mistaken? 😉

    Now as the original fault WAS the heating element and that has been replaced, I would think the BIT100 control board has given up the ghost as a result??
